Doctor Who aired in these cities, on these channels:


St Paul / Minneapolis

KSTP

Channel 5 (ABC affiliate)

This channel serviced both St Paul and Minneapolis.

Channel 5 screened the Tom Baker stories until at least 1981.

St Paul

KTCA

Channel 2 (PBS)

Channel 2 screened the Tom Baker stories from January 1982, Monday to Friday at 5.00pm; the timeslot later changed to 5.30pm.

In 1983, the series moved to Fridays at 10.30pm with the compilation editions. A second compilation was eventually added to the schedule, on Saturday nights. In late 1986, the series aired on Saturdays only, at 10.00pm.

In the mid 1980s, channel 2 screened the 17 repackaged William Hartnell stories. The second half of The Chase (i.e. parts 4-6) aired on Friday 16 May 1986.

The repackaged Jon Pertwee stories screened by September 1988.
